adjective informal B1 property
1

Extremely foolish or unreasonable

Very silly or unreasonable; not making sense.

Модел на употреба: [someone/something] is insane
Честа грешка:
Learners sometimes confuse this meaning with the medical sense of 'mentally ill', which is less common in everyday speech.

adjective B2 state
2

Having a severe mental illness

Having a serious mental illness that changes how someone thinks or acts.

Модел на употреба: [someone] is insane
Честа грешка:
Learners often overuse this meaning in casual contexts where 'crazy' or 'ridiculous' would be more appropriate.

adjective informal B2 property
3

Extremely impressive or exciting

Very exciting or amazing; hard to believe because it is so good or extreme.

Модел на употреба: [something] is insane
Честа грешка:
Learners may confuse this with the negative senses of 'insane', but here it is positive slang for 'amazing'.
